Mastering Efficiency: A Career in Production Engineering
A career in production engineering presents a unique opportunity to combine technical expertise with the dynamic realm of manufacturing. These professionals are in charge of streamlining processes, reducing waste, and optimizing overall efficiency. Production engineers utilize their knowledge of industrial processes to develop innovative solutions that increase production capacity while maintaining the highest quality of product quality.
Their responsibilities can span everything from executing time studies to putting into action new technologies, and from diagnosing production issues to working with cross-functional teams. A career in production engineering is a constantly changing field that calls for a commitment for continuous learning and improvement.
- Additionally, production engineers often have a crucial part in introducing lean manufacturing principles, which aim to minimize waste at every stage of the production process.
- Their work also affects directly to profitability, making them essential members to any manufacturing organization.
From Concept to Creation: The Role of Production Engineers
Production engineers serve in the vital role of bridging the gap between innovative concepts and tangible products. Their expertise encompasses a wide range of disciplines, such as manufacturing processes, material science, and quality control. From initial design stages to the final deployment, production engineers maintain that products are manufactured efficiently, effectively, and consistently. They work together with designers, engineers, and other stakeholders to improve production methods, reduce costs, and enhance product quality. By applying their in-depth knowledge and problem-solving skills, production engineers contribute to the achievement of any manufacturing endeavor.
